How long is midwifery school?

By Zippia Team - Dec. 9, 2022

Midwifery school is typically three years in length. In order to go to midwifery school a candidate must first complete a BSN, which normally takes around three to four years.

A midwife is a trained health professional who helps healthy women during labor, delivery, and after the birth of their babies.

Midwives are trained to provide obstetric and gynecological services, including primary care, prenatal and obstetric care, and routine gynecological care like annual exams and contraception.

They are experts in uncomplicated Ob/Gyn care. Midwives are also present during delivery and help mothers with strategies such as breathing.
